About The Position

Acara Solutions is seeking a Quality Control Senior Manager to join our client, a manufacturer in Saratoga Springs, NY. The Quality Control Senior Manager oversees all quality activities in a manufacturing environment producing electronics, power supplies, and transformers for industrial and U.S. military customers. This role leads the quality team and ensures products meet company, customer, and regulatory requirements. The position supports compliance with ISO 9001 and AS9100 and drives continuous improvement across operations.

Requirements

  • Bachelor's degree in Electrical, Mechanical, Industrial, or Manufacturing Engineering (or equivalent experience).
  • 7+ years of progressive experience in quality control or assurance within industrial or electronic manufacturing environments.
  • 3+ years of management or supervisory experience leading quality teams.
  • Strong working knowledge of MIL-SPEC, ISO 9000, and ISO 9001:2015 standards
  • Experience with ERP and Quality Management Systems (QMS) software.
  • U.S. citizen with the ability to secure a U.S. Government security clearance; must meet eligibility requirements for access to export-controlled data.

Nice To Haves

  • Experience working with DoD, aerospace, or defense manufacturing contracts highly preferred.
  • Strong working knowledge of IPC-A-610 and J-STD-001
  • Proficient in using inspection and test equipment (oscilloscopes, DMMs, hipot testers, etc.).
  • Skilled in statistical process control (SPC) , root cause analysis (RCA) , 8D problem-solving , and FMEA .
  • Familiarity with transformer winding , power supply testing , and PCB assembly processes.
  • ASQ Certified Quality Engineer (CQE), Certified Quality Manager (CQM), or equivalent.
  • Six Sigma Green or Black Belt certification.
  • IPC Certification (J-STD-001, IPC-A-610, or IPC-7711/7721)

Responsibilities

  • Lead, train, and support QC engineers, inspectors, and technicians
  • Assign inspection and testing work to meet production schedules
  • Act as the main contact for internal, customer, and government audits
  • Promote a strong safety and quality culture
  • Set and enforce inspection, testing, and sampling requirements
  • Manage First Article Inspections (FAIs) and Certificates of Conformance (CoCs)
  • Oversee calibration and control of measurement and test equipment
  • Manage nonconforming material and MRB activities
  • Ensure compliance with MIL-SPEC, IPC, ISO 9001, and AS9100 standards
  • Maintain accurate quality records and inspection documentation
  • Support DCMA and military customer source inspections
  • Lead root cause analysis and corrective/preventive actions (CAPA)
  • Manage internal and supplier audits
  • Track and analyze quality metrics such as defects, rework, and scrap
  • Work with Engineering and Production to improve product quality
  • Apply Lean and Six Sigma tools to reduce variation and improve processes
  • Recommend improvements in inspection methods and automation
